Method

Preparation Steps

  1. 1

    Prepare the Potatoes

    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Wash and scrub the Yukon Gold potatoes thoroughly. Cut them into halves or quarters, depending on their size.

  2. 2

    Boil the Potatoes

    In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add the cut potatoes and boil for about 15-20 minutes, or until fork-tender. Drain and let them cool slightly.

  3. 3

    Crush the Potatoes

    On a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, place the boiled potatoes. Using a fork or a potato masher, gently crush each potato until they are flattened but still intact.

  4. 4

    Add Seasoning

    In a small bowl, mix the olive oil, minced garlic, chopped rosemary, salt, and black pepper. Drizzle this mixture over the crushed potatoes, ensuring they are well coated.

  5. 5

    Bake the Potatoes

    Transfer the baking sheet to the preheated oven and bake for about 25-30 minutes or until the potatoes are golden brown and crispy.

  6. 6

    Serve

    Remove from the oven and let cool slightly before serving. Enjoy your delicious Crushed Yukons!
